Rates & Terms

Alternative and online lenders in TX offer faster approval but charge 15% to 60% APR equivalent on short-term products.

SBA 7(a) loans in Webster typically range from 11.5% to 15% APR, including the prime rate plus a spread.

Requirements in Webster

A business bank account, EIN, and appropriate licenses are required before applying for financing in TX.

Lenders will review your business bank statements, tax returns, profit and loss statements, and balance sheet.

Texas Regulations

Texas regulates payday lenders as Credit Access Businesses with fee disclosures.

  • Usury Limit: 10% (non-licensed), no limit (written commercial)
  • Payday Lending: Legal, no limit, regulated as CABs

Borrowing Tips for Webster

  • Prepare a detailed business plan with financial projections before approaching lenders; it dramatically improves approval odds.
  • Build business credit separately from personal credit by opening vendor accounts and paying bills on time.
  • Avoid merchant cash advances unless absolutely necessary; the effective APR can exceed 100% on short-term products.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the best type of business loan for a startup in Webster?

SBA microloans, community development financial institutions, and equipment financing are often the best options for startups lacking the 2-year history banks require.

Can I get a business loan with bad credit?

Yes, but expect higher rates and shorter terms. Consider revenue-based financing, invoice factoring, or finding a creditworthy co-signer to improve your offer.

Do I need collateral for a business loan in Webster?

SBA and traditional bank loans typically require collateral. Unsecured business loans and lines of credit are available but carry higher rates and lower limits.

How much can I borrow for my business in TX?

SBA 7(a) loans max at $5 million. Traditional bank loans in Webster typically range from $25,000 to $500,000. Online lenders may offer $5,000 to $250,000.
